O'ROURKE, James
Cause of his death was influenza over 2 months and acute bronchitis over 1 month.4 Another name for James was RORK, James.1 General Notes: The 1881 census for Old Monkland recorded this family residing at Bells Land, Langloan. James Rourke, his wife Mary, and their five children lived there. James was Irish born and aged 31 years. He worked as a coal miner. Medical Notes: J. L. White MB CM certified the causes of death. Noted events in his life were: • Census: UK, 1861, Bothwell Parish, Lanarkshire, Scotland. James married Mary Gibson HODGE, daughter of Thomas HODGE and Christina Smith BLACKWOOD, on 30 Dec 1870 in The Manse, Old Monkland, Lanarkshire, Scotland.1 2 (Mary Gibson HODGE was born on 16 Jun 1852 in Muirkirk, Ayrshire, Scotland 1, christened on 11 Jul 1852 in Muirkirk, Ayrshire, Scotland 1 and died after 3 Apr 1908 4.) Marriage Notes: The marriage was celebrated after banns, according to the forms of the Church of Scotland. The minister was P. Cameron Black, minister of Old Monkland. James next married Bridget McGONIGLE on 29 Aug 1843 in Leith, Midlothian, Scotland.3 (Bridget McGONIGLE was born about 1830.) |
